Cayenne Turbo S - The Works

In Stunning Black!

Project Scope:

Paint Protection Film (aka clear bra) on:
1. Full Hood
2. Full Front Fenders
3. Front Bumper
4. Lights
5. Mirrors
6. Rocker Panels (really necessary since this is entirely exposed to rocks being thrown up from the front tires)
7. Full Rear Bumper

Beltronics STiR + Laser Interceptor Quad System
1. Fully customized system mount points for OEM look
2. Custom leather wrapped control module
3. Beltronics Overhead Display Above Mirror
4. Parking Sensor Installation (from the Laser Interceptor System)

Spectra PhotoSync Nano Tint
1. Front Driver / Passenger Windows - 45%
2. Front Windshield - 75%
3. All Glasses Behind Front Doors - 65%

Today we took a quick surface temperature reading on a 2014 VW Touareg we just received. The car was sitting outside for 15 minutes before we brought the vehicle inside to our facility. But before we did, we found these astounding numbers:

Front driver seat - 156 degrees F
Front driver side dash - 163 degrees F

This is the reason dashboards and leather seats tend to crack over time. Daily exposure to the sun's UV and infrared rays can wear down the interior significantly in a short amount of time. When it comes to paint protection, there are varying factors that determine how visible it is on the car:

1. The film - some films exhibit more orange peel texture than others, which is most noticeable on dark colored vehicles.
2. Custom or precut templates - the precut templates will have more seams than custom. However, when it comes to custom applications, it takes a tremendous amount of experience and skill to be able to execute so the film is not visible to most.
3. Regardless of custom or precut, the most important of all would be the installer. Installers come and go in this industry and many companies do not actually perform the installations themselves. Due to the amount of time it takes to hone in the skills of paint protection film, many companies do not have the luxury of learning a new trade. In this aspect, they would rather hire out someone to do the work for them. This would mean that you are paying a higher premium as the contracting company would need to mark up the services to make margin. In addition, the natural issue with this is that many companies use a bidding process to find the cheapest company to act as their in-house vendor, which also means there is potentially the issue of using a less experienced company for the work

Overall, keep your eyes out for the top 3 points, and this would give you an added edge when it comes to finding a quality company to perform the work and make it look very good.
